FAQs about Comparative Test of 500kW Photovoltaic Container at Weather Station

How efficient are pvmet weather stations?

Efficiency of modules typically drops around 0.5% per 1°C temperature rise, compared to the standard test condition of 25°C. Track panel temperatures to determine temperature-related losses. All but one the PVmet weather stations include a back of panel temperature sensor and support one additional one.

How does NASA-SSE meteorological data compare with PVSyst data?

NASA-SSE meteorological data (irradiation, temperature) entered in PVsyst software are presented and compared with the data measured in the study site. The measured average daily solar radiation derived from NASA shows a deviation that varies between 8% and 30% during most months in Fig. 3, except in April, when the deviation is zero.

How much money can a photovoltaic panel scam defraud at most

How much money can a photovoltaic panel scam defraud at most

These fees can add as much as 30 percent to the total cost of a solar panel system. Perhaps most concerning, certain demographics face heightened vulnerability. Many fraudulent practices specifically target elderly homeowners and people who are not native English speakers. As more families consider solar energy improvements, dishonest companies exploit the fine print in solar panel. . Demand for solar-powered home systems has increased rapidly in the last several years. To avoid getting scammed, you need to know what to look out for and when to walk away. Here's our guide to. . Did a salesperson knock on your door and promise free rooftop solar panels at no cost to you? Or say you'll never have to pay another electricity bill because government programs, grants, or rebates cover your solar installation? It's likely a scam. [PDF Version]
